Address 0 PPC

PLrEpfTtxbFSCMnpbEH6uqd25mha46eqdj

Confirmed

Total Received156.549124 PPC
Total Sent156.549124 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.02 PPC
403868 Confirmations3553.224509 PPC
PLrEpfTtxbFSCMnpbEH6uqd25mha46eqdj156.549124 PPC
PJdaUR24hjvsDdAaQGYo757FmfCqRG3F2j27.330876 PPC
Fee: 0.01 PPC
404017 Confirmations183.88 PPC